Average Cost of Solar Panels in Carol Stream

Find out what the average cost of a solar system is in Carol Stream.

In Carol Stream, solar panels cost about 2.73 per watt on average. The average solar panel system size in Carol Stream is around 6.5 kilowatts, meaning a cost of about $12,479 for a solar installation, or $17,845 before the 30% federal solar tax credit is applied.

Keep in mind that the figures above are only estimates based on the average Carol Stream homeowner. The cost of a solar system for your home may be different depending on factors unique to your situation, like your household energy use and solar contractor. Many homeowners find adopting solar power is a rewarding investment. The average homeowner in Carol Stream can save around $15,000 on their power bills over 20 years.

Factors that Affect Solar Panel Costs in Carol Stream

Cost is often one of the most important factors for homeowners considering investing in solar. There are a few major factors that affect your total cost in Carol Stream: solar equipment and system size, financing options and the solar installation company you choose. We'll go over each of these briefly below.

Solar Equipment

The size of the solar system you need, which is measured in kilowatts, is the most significant cost factor to consider. For every additional kilowatt you need, your total will most likely increase by nearly $2,730. The brand and kind of equipment you get for your solar system can increase or decrease the price quite significantly. If you prefer a trusted brand name like Tesla or SunPower, these often have a higher price tag than other brands. Efficiency also matters. Whether you're opting for high efficiency because you have limited roof space or just want maximum energy production, you will be looking at a higher equipment cost, but this can typically lead to more savings over time. Plus, if you want additional equipment like an electric vehicle charger or solar batteries, this will also increase the cost.

Solar Financing Terms

Many homeowners find the average cost of solar in Carol Stream to be too steep, even if the investment pays off over time. Thankfully, almost every solar company in the area provides financing options. Solar loans substantially decrease upfront costs for most homeowners, but they also result in paying more over time because of interest. It's wise to factor the interest you'll pay in your final cost estimate. If you can afford to put more money down upfront, you can reduce your total costs and how long it'll take to pay back the loan.

Solar Panel Installation Company

The remaining key cost factor you should consider is the installer you choose. Given the booming popularity of green energy solutions in Carol Stream, you'll have many options to choose from, but each comes at different price points for labor and equipment. You may notice national solar installers that have lower prices because of their bigger brand name and access to bulk equipment pricing, or you might see small, local installation companies offering deals or promotions to compete with those larger companies.

How to Save on Solar Panels

The solar installer you go with will impact not only your total costs, but also the kinds of solar panel brands, warranties, and other equipment you can get. When choosing a solar company, there are some important things you should take into account, such as:

  • Installation Process: Homeowners should understand how exactly the installation process will go, as well as important factors like the project completion timeline.
  • Reputation: Your solar installer should have a sound reputation as a company and have verifiable expertise in the field. A couple of ways to check this are to look for whether a company has technicians certified by the North American Board of Certified Energy Practitioners (NABCEP) and if it has satisfied reviews from past customers.
  • Solar Panel Brands: Each solar panel brand and model offers varying levels of quality, longevity and efficiency. They will come at different costs as well. The company you choose impacts which solar panel brands you have access to.
  • Contract: When looking over your solar company's contract, ask questions about any terms you're not sure of and make sure you understand what happens in scenarios like a system component breaking or the company going out of business.

What other factors should I consider other than cost when buying solar panels?

The upfront cost is a very important factor to consider, but whether it's the most important for you depends on your reasons for going solar. In places where rooftop space is limited, efficiency can be more important than the cost. Other factors that are important to take into account are the quality and durability of your solar panels.

Does Carol Stream have a net metering program?

The majority of states offer net metering programs of some kind. Through these, you can either be compensated for the extra power your system generates or or receive credits to put toward future utility bills. Currently there are just three states that don't have any net metering laws: Alabama, Tennessee and South Dakota.

How many solar panels should I get to power my home?

The exact number of solar panels you need depends on your household energy consumption and how much sunlight your roof gets. You can look at your energy bills for the past year to get an idea of the solar system size you'll need. The average household has to buy between 20 and 35 panels to account for their typical energy usage.
